Topics in Logic: This book introduces the reader to some basic concepts in mathematical logic and propositional calculus. Topics in formal theories are briefly analyzed. First-order predicate calculus is described including some of its interpretations in arithmetic and set theory. Axiomatic set theories are covered. Some examples of axiomatic set theories are also illustrated. Relations are defined along with basic concepts of homomorphism and congruence. Finally universal algebras are defined and some of their properties discussed.

Autorenporträt
Dr. Milan Frankl, MBA, PhD, was a senior executive of a number of high-tech Canadian firms. He studied Computer Science and Information Technology at the University of Victoria. He teaches business and computer science at the University of Victoria and University Canada West. He is a principal with MFA Inc. a management consulting firm in Victoria.
